  4. They are *VERY* good. You won't be disappointed if you get one. However, they are not available new any more. They have been replaced by the Canon 40D. Used a 30D will be about $1000. At that price, you can look at a new Nikon D80. For a few hundred more, you can also get a new Canon 40D. When you buy an SLR, you also need to buy a lens for it; usually, you can get a lens included as part of a standard kit. Ignore the poster who says they are "complex cameras". That answer tells me he's never actually used one. The 30D (and 40D and Nikon D80) has modes for beginners, including a full-auto everything mode, just like a point and shoot camera. However, unlike point and shoot cameras, the 30D also can expand as your skills and interests grow, so that you don't outgrow the camera. Whatever camera you get--enjoy it and have fun!
